AI summary

Awfis Space Solutions, India's largest flexible workspace provider, reported FY25 revenue of Rs. 1,208 crores, up 42% year-on-year, with operating EBITDA of Rs. 402 crores, up 64%, and EBITDA margin expanding by about 440 basis points to 33.3%. Q4 FY25 revenue rose 46% YoY to Rs. 340 crores with EBITDA margin at 34.1%. The company met its FY25 guidance of 135K operational seats, ending the year with 134,121 operational seats across 208 centers in 18 cities, having added 39,091 seats and 48 new centers during the year. About 67% of total seats operate under the capital-efficient Managed Aggregation model. New client wins include NSE and several Global Capability Centres, with new allied services launched such as Awfis Cafe, TechLabs, and a corporate transport partnership with ECOS Mobility. ROCE improved to 62% in FY25 from 43% in FY24, and Fitch upgraded the company's credit rating from A to A+ with a stable outlook.
